2. Jesus' Explicit Declaration: The Holy Spirit Was NOT Yet Given

The Gospel of John contains a passage of such clarity and temporal specificity that it cannot be misunderstood. In John 7:37–39, Jesus makes a declaration that is foundational to understanding the entire Christian promise of salvation:

"If anyone thirsts, let him come to Me and drink. He who believes in Me, as the Scripture has said, from his innermost being will flow rivers of living water. But this He spoke of the Spirit, whom those who believed in Him were to receive; for the Spirit was not yet given, because Jesus was not yet glorified." (John 7:37–39)

This passage contains four critical elements that must be carefully examined:

The Paraclete Shri Mataji

First, the promise itself: From his innermost being will flow rivers of living water. This is not a metaphorical or poetic statement. Jesus is describing an actual, experiential reality—the indwelling of the Divine Spirit that will produce a powerful, transformative flow from the deepest center of the believer's being. The use of the plural rivers emphasizes the abundance and power of this spiritual reality.

Second, the identification of the gift: But this He spoke of the Spirit. The Gospel author—John himself—provides an explicit editorial clarification. The living water is not Jesus himself. The living water is the Holy Spirit. This is not ambiguous. The giver (Jesus) and the gift (the Holy Spirit) are ontologically distinct. Jesus is the mediator; the Spirit is the substance of salvation.

Third, the recipients: Whom those who believed in Him were to receive. The use of the future tense were to receive is critical. This is not a present reality during Jesus' earthly ministry. This is a future event. Those who believe in Jesus will receive the Spirit, but not immediately. The reception is future.

Fourth, and most importantly, the temporal condition: For the Spirit was not yet given, because Jesus was not yet glorified. This is the key to understanding the entire passage. The Holy Spirit had not yet been given. Why? Because Jesus had not yet been glorified. The giving of the Spirit is explicitly conditioned upon the glorification of Jesus. Until Jesus is glorified, the Spirit cannot be given. This is not a matter of interpretation; it is a matter of explicit statement.

The implications of this passage are profound and far-reaching. Jesus is saying that during his earthly ministry, the indwelling of the Holy Spirit—the rivers of living water—was not available to believers. The Spirit was not yet given. The promise was future. The fulfillment would come only after Jesus' glorification.

4. The Glorification Requirement: Jesus Must Be Glorified First

The condition for the giving of the Holy Spirit is stated with complete clarity in John 7:39: “the Spirit was not yet given, because Jesus was not yet glorified.” This statement establishes an explicit sequence. The Spirit cannot be given until Jesus is glorified; glorification is not optional or symbolic but a necessary prerequisite.

Within mainstream Christian theology, Jesus’ glorification is generally interpreted as referring to his resurrection and ascension—his return to the Father and exaltation at God’s right hand. On this basis, the Church maintains that the Holy Spirit was given shortly thereafter, most notably at Pentecost.

Yet this interpretation assumes that glorification is a completed event rather than a process unfolding in history. A deeper reading of Jesus’ own words suggests otherwise.
